include(*.txt) .... Formatierung verschwindet

Alles, was PHP betrifft, kann hier besprochen werden.

include(*.txt) .... Formatierung verschwindet

Postby basti.sz » 12. October 2006 16:11

Hi Leute

Habe jetzt folgende Frage:
Wenn ich eine Text-Datei per include aufrufe, dann zeigt er mir nicht den formatierten Text sondern verändert alles.
Das heißt das alle Zeilenumbrüche etc. weg sind.
Kann man das verhindern, ohne <br> etc. im Dokument einfügen zu müssen.

Ich will auch einer Doc Datei eine .txt machen und diese dann einfügen.

Grüße und Danke im Voraus
Basti
basti.sz
 
Posts: 12
Joined: 09. October 2006 17:24

Postby Wiedmann » 12. October 2006 16:17

Wenn ich eine Text-Datei per include aufrufe, dann zeigt er mir nicht den formatierten Text sondern verändert alles.

Inwiefern ist der Text formatiert?

Das heißt das alle Zeilenumbrüche etc. weg sind.
Kann man das verhindern, ohne <br> etc. im Dokument einfügen zu müssen.

Also soweit es Zeilenumbrüche angeht...:
Ein Zeilenumbruch (\r\n) im Quellcode einer HTML-Datei, zeigt ein Webbrowser nach Rendern des MarkUp's nicht an. In HTML werden neue Zeilen erst einmal nur bei Blockelementen bekonnen, oder halt bei einem "<br>".
Wiedmann
AF Moderator
 
Posts: 17102
Joined: 01. February 2004 12:38
Location: Stuttgart / Germany

Postby basti.sz » 12. October 2006 16:41

Der Text ist z.B. so formatiert:
Code: Select all
xxxxxxxxxxxx

bbbbbbbbbbbbbbbb
            ccccccccccccccc


Ausgegeben wird der Text folgendermaßen:
Code: Select all
xxxxxxxxxxxxbbbbbb
bbbbbbbbbbccccccccc
cccccc
[/code]

Grüße
Basti
basti.sz
 
Posts: 12
Joined: 09. October 2006 17:24

Postby Wiedmann » 12. October 2006 16:45

Siehe oben:
Ein Zeilenumbruch, Tabulator oder mehr wie ein Leerzeichen um Quellcode, interessiert HTML nicht (es sei denn, es kommt innerhalb von "<pre>" vor).

So als Tipp sollte man sich vor PHP mit den Grundlagen von HTML beschäftigen. z.B. hier:
http://de.selfhtml.org/html/index.htm

Oder wenn man es offiziell haben will:
http://www.w3.org/TR/html4/
Wiedmann
AF Moderator
 
Posts: 17102
Joined: 01. February 2004 12:38
Location: Stuttgart / Germany

Postby basti.sz » 13. October 2006 11:12

Thx

Es hat geklappt...

Grüße
Basti
basti.sz
 
Posts: 12
Joined: 09. October 2006 17:24


Return to PHP

Who is online

Users browsing this forum: No registered users and 10 guests